Product Overview: Built for Abuse

 

Standard rotary valves are fine for sawdust. But for Boiler Ash, Cement Clinker, or Sand, you need a Rigid Impeller Feeder. The term "Rigid" refers to the rotor construction: it is cast as a solid piece or welded with thick steel plates, designed to crush small lumps that would jam a standard valve.

Key Features: Outboard Bearings

 

The #1 cause of failure in heavy industry is dust entering the bearings or heat melting the grease.

  • The Solution: We use an Outboard Bearing Design. The bearings are mounted outside the main housing, separated by a gap and packing seals.
  • Benefit 1: If the seal leaks, dust falls on the ground, not into the bearing.
  • Benefit 2: It creates a thermal break, allowing the valve to handle materials up to 250°C - 400°C without cooking the bearing grease.

Anti-Jamming Design

 

  • Shear Angle Inlet: We design the inlet with a V-shape "shear point". If a rock gets caught between the blade and the housing, the Scissor-like action cuts it or pushes it aside, preventing the rotor from locking up.
  • Open-End Rotor: Prevents material from building up on the side plates of the rotor (Deep Pocket design).

Typical Applications

 

  • Power Plants: Handling bottom ash and fly ash (High Temp).
  • Cement Plants: Discharge of raw meal and clinker.
  • Mining: Feeding crushed ore onto conveyors.

 

FAQ

 

Q: What is the max particle size it can handle?

A: It depends on the valve size. Generally, the particle size should be less than 10% of the inlet diameter to prevent jamming.

 

Q: Is the rotor replaceable?

A: Yes. The end covers can be removed to slide out the rotor for replacement or hard-facing repair without removing the entire valve body from the line.
